# Labnex CLI Verification Guide
This guide helps you verify that your Labnex CLI installation is working correctly.
## 1. Verify Installation
Run the following command to check that the CLI is installed:
```bash
labnex --version
```
You should see output similar to:
```
1.3.0
```
If you get a "command not found" error, try reinstalling the CLI:
```bash
npm install -g @labnex/cli
```
## 2. Check Help System
Run the help command to verify that the CLI help system is working:
```bash
labnex --help
```
You should see a detailed help output with all available commands.
## 3. Test Configuration
Verify your API configuration:
```bash
labnex config get
```
If your configuration is missing or incomplete, set it up:
```bash
labnex config set
```
## 4. Test Authentication
Check if you're authenticated:
```bash
labnex auth status
```
If not authenticated, log in:
```bash
labnex auth login
```
## 5. Test Basic Commands
Try listing projects to ensure API connectivity:
```bash
labnex list --projects
```
## 6. Test Run Command
If you have a project set up, try running a simple test:
```bash
labnex run --project-id <YOUR_PROJECT_ID> --verbose
```
## Troubleshooting
### API Connection Issues
If you can't connect to the API:
1. Check your internet connection
2. Verify your API configuration with `labnex config get`
3. Try setting a custom API URL with `labnex config set --api-url <URL>`
### Browser/WebDriver Issues
If you encounter browser automation errors:
1. Make sure you have the latest browser versions installed
2. Try running with `--headless` flag
3. Use `--verbose` for detailed logs
### Permission Issues
If you get permission errors:
1. Try running with administrator privileges
2. Check file permissions in your home directory
3. Verify that you have write access to the Labnex configuration directory
